DOLAN Uyghur Restaurant specializes in the vibrant culinary traditions of the Silk Road by focusing on authentic hand-pulled noodles and fragrant spice-laden meat dishes. The menu prominently features signature plates like lagman, which consists of chewy wheat noodles tossed with fresh vegetables and tender proteins in a savory sauce. Diners encounter bold flavors derived from cumin, chili, and garlic that define this distinct regional cuisine. The kitchen employs traditional cooking techniques including charcoal grilling to prepare succulent skewers seasoned with proprietary spice blends. This establishment provides a direct experience of Central Asian gastronomy through a menu that emphasizes hearty, hand-crafted preparations. Patrons find a dedicated focus on meat-centric BBQ items paired with various steamed breads and dumplings that showcase the diverse influences shaping this unique and historic food culture.

### The Food is Mind-Blowingly Authentic & Delicious
Everything we tried was cooked to perfection. Generous portions, fresh ingredients, & flavors that taste like they've been handed down for generations.
- **Petr Manti (Steamed Manti)**: Delicate steamed dumplings with seasoned lamb & onions. The dough was perfectly thin, the filling juicy & flavorful. Some of the best manti I've ever tasted.
- **Samsa**: Flaky, golden baked pastries filled with spiced beef & onions. Crispy outside, savory & aromatic inside. These vanished instantly.
- **Pilov (Plov / Polo)**: The king of Uyghur rice dishes. Fragrant rice perfectly cooked with tender lamb, carrots, onions, & spices. Hearty, comforting, & each grain soaked in flavor.
- **Lagman**: Fresh hand-pulled noodles in a bold, spicy, umami-rich sauce with vegetables & meat. That signature chewy texture from the hand-pulled noodles made it outstanding.
- **Strawberry Drinks**: Refreshing, naturally sweet, & the perfect cooling contrast to all the bold spices. Light, fruity, & highly recommended.
